Predicting disulfide bond connectivity in proteins by correlated mutations analysis.
Bioinformatics (Oxford, England) - 15 Feb 2008
Rubinstein Rotem, Fiser Andras
Abstract excerpt
MOTIVATION: Prediction of disulfide bond connectivity facilitates structural and functional annotation of proteins. Previous studies suggest that cysteines of a disulfide bond mutate in a correlated manner. RESULTS: We developed a method that analyzes correlated mutation patterns in multiple sequence alignments in order to predict disulfide bond connectivity.
